EMPLOYEE DENIES THEFT

CHRISTCHURCH CLERK CHARGED. By Telegraph—Press Association. Christchurch, July 9. James Joseph Thomas Morris, aged 22, clerk, was charged this morning with the theft of sums totalling £403, the property of J. C. Hutton (New Zealand), Ltd., of which firm he was an employee. Morris pleaded not guilty and was committed for trial,
